What Is a Wireless Credit Card Skimmer and How Does It Differ from Traditional Skimmers
A wireless credit card skimmer operates by intercepting data transmitted between your card and a payment terminal. Unlike traditional magnetic stripe skimmers that require physical card insertion, wireless skimmers capture RFID or NFC signals emitted by contactless cards and digital wallets. The device reads the card's outer layer data—typically the card number, expiration date, and sometimes the cardholder name—without requiring the card to be inserted or swiped. Wireless RFID credit card skimmers can operate from several feet away, making them harder to detect than gas pump or ATM insert skimmers. A credit card skimmer in general refers to any device designed to steal card data, but wireless variants pose unique challenges because they leave no visible trace and require no tampering with physical infrastructure.

What Happens When You Use or Possess a Cloned Card: Legal Consequences
Possession of a cloned card or a device designed to create one carries serious criminal charges that vary by jurisdiction. In most legal systems, charges fall into three categories: fraud (using the card to make unauthorized purchases), identity theft (using another person's financial identity), and device-based fraud (possessing or manufacturing skimming equipment). Penalties depend on the specific statute, the amount defrauded, and prior criminal history. Some jurisdictions impose mandatory minimum sentences for organized card fraud schemes. Conviction can result in felony charges, prison time, substantial fines, restitution to victims, and a permanent criminal record affecting employment and housing. Even possession without use can trigger charges under laws prohibiting fraud devices or conspiracy. How to Detect a Wireless Card Skimmer and Protect Your Payment Information
Detection of a wireless RFID credit card skimmer is challenging because the device operates without visible tampering. However, several protective measures reduce your risk. Inspect payment terminals for loose, bulky, or misaligned components before inserting your card. Request the cashier to run your card through their terminal rather than handing it to them. Use contactless or chip-based payments when available, as they employ encryption and tokenization that make captured data less useful. Enable transaction alerts on your bank account to receive notifications of purchases in real time. Consider using virtual card numbers or single-use payment tokens offered by many banks and digital wallet providers. RFID-blocking wallets provide a physical barrier, though their effectiveness is debated. The most reliable protection is monitoring your statements regularly and disputing unauthorized charges immediately. Use a wireless card skimmer detector app or dedicated RFID scanner if you work in high-risk environments, though consumer-grade tools have limited accuracy.
What to Do If Your Card Data Has Been Compromised or You Detect Fraud
If you discover unauthorized charges or suspect your card data has been stolen, contact your bank or card issuer immediately. Most issuers offer fraud protection that limits your liability to zero or a small amount, depending on your account agreement and when you report the fraud. Request a new card with a different number and ask the issuer to investigate the fraudulent transactions. File a dispute for each unauthorized charge; the issuer typically has 30 to 60 days to investigate and respond. Document all communications with your bank in writing. Check your credit report for signs of identity theft, such as accounts opened in your name. Place a fraud alert with the credit bureaus if identity theft is suspected. Report the incident to local law enforcement and file a complaint with the Federal Trade Commission or your country's equivalent consumer protection agency. Refund timelines vary by issuer but typically range from 5 to 10 business days for provisional credits and 30 to 90 days for full investigation resolution. Keep records of all documentation for your protection.

What is the difference between a wireless card skimmer and a shimmer?
A wireless skimmer captures contactless or RFID data remotely, while a shimmer is a thin device inserted into a card slot that reads the EMV chip data during insertion. Shimmers are physical devices requiring access to the card slot, whereas wireless skimmers operate without contact. Both steal card data, but wireless skimmers are harder to detect because they leave no visible trace and can operate from a distance.

What payment methods are safest against wireless skimmers?
Chip-based EMV payments, virtual card numbers, single-use tokens, and digital wallets with tokenization offer strong protection. These methods encrypt or replace your actual card data, making captured information less useful to fraudsters. Contactless payments with authentication or biometric verification are also relatively secure. Avoid swiping magnetic stripe cards when chip or contactless options are available.
